EOSC vs. Meridian Technology Center

Both Eastern Oklahoma State College and Meridian Technology Center are Public, 2-4 years schools located in Oklahoma. The following statements compare Eastern Oklahoma State College and Meridian Technology Center with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are public.
  • EOSC's tuition ($8,384) is more expensive than Meridian Technology Center ($1,800).
  • Meridian Technology Center's students to faculty ratio (8 to 1) is lower than EOSC (16 to 1).
  • EOSC (1,238 students) is larger than Meridian Technology Center (806 students) with more enrolled students.
  • EOSC ($5,106) has higher amount of financial aid than Meridian Technology Center ($3,772).
  • Meridian Technology Center's graduation rate (60%) is higher than EOSC (30%).
